Output e8dc8faf44b13a4cf8b66ac8f1407a9877d5a9b407a860ffda24c21940f002ea:4

value
131065
script pubkey
OP_0 OP_PUSHBYTES_20 0d2361d5f5066b5494961d7016809c4d9408b2fe
address
bc1qp53kr404qe44f9ykr4cpdqyufk2q3vh7t0u69a
transaction
e8dc8faf44b13a4cf8b66ac8f1407a9877d5a9b407a860ffda24c21940f002ea
confirmations
218072
spent
true